Transaction bc75d4fcc2ccecd695ae4eb42e9a35b806780d17be9f89b5408253703dd95e7b

block
f034100b2154f92012f9b72b43b734825569b394bbcecc437c03e35ea45dca49

1 Input

23 Outputs